What is a Brake Controller?

A brake controller is a device that allows a driver to control the electric brakes on a trailer. It is typically installed in the driver’s cab and is connected to the vehicle’s electrical system and the trailer’s braking system. This device is crucial for ensuring the safe operation of a trailer, especially when towing heavy loads or driving on steep or slippery terrain.

How does a brake controller work?

A brake controller works by sending electrical signals to the trailer’s braking system, which then activates the electric brakes on the trailer. This allows the driver to control the braking force applied to the trailer, independently of the vehicle’s braking system. The controller is usually connected to the vehicle’s brake switch or brake pedal, so that when the driver applies the brakes, the trailer’s brakes are also engaged.

Why is a brake controller necessary?

Using a brake controller is essential when towing a trailer that is equipped with electric brakes. Without a brake controller, the driver would have limited control over the trailer’s braking system, which could lead to unsafe driving conditions. The brake controller ensures that the trailer’s brakes are applied smoothly and evenly, allowing for better handling and stopping distances.

Overview of brake controllers for the 2016 Sprinter van

When it comes to towing a trailer with your 2016 Sprinter van, having a brake controller is essential for ensuring the safety and stability of your vehicle and cargo. A brake controller is a device that allows the driver to control the brakes on the trailer independently of the Sprinter’s brakes.

There are several options available for brake controllers that are compatible with the 2016 Sprinter van:

  • Inertia-based brake controllers: These controllers use sensors to detect the deceleration of the vehicle and apply the trailer brakes accordingly. This type of brake controller is easy to install and provides smooth and proportional braking.
  • Time-based brake controllers: These controllers apply a preset amount of braking power to the trailer brakes based on a time delay. While they are simple to use, they may not provide as precise braking control as inertia-based controllers.
  • Proportional brake controllers: Proportional brake controllers offer the most advanced braking control by measuring the deceleration of the tow vehicle and applying the trailer brakes in proportion to that deceleration. This ensures that the braking force is always matched to the towing conditions, providing optimal safety and stability.

Common issues with brake controller wiring for the 2016 Sprinter

When it comes to brake controller wiring for the 2016 Sprinter, there are a few common issues that owners may encounter. These issues can result in the brake controller not functioning as expected, which can be a safety concern. It’s important to address these issues promptly to ensure the safe operation of the vehicle.

1. Faulty wiring connections: One of the most common issues with brake controller wiring is faulty connections. This can happen if the wiring is not properly secured or if there is a loose or broken connection. It’s important to carefully inspect all connections and ensure they are secure and in good condition. If any issues are found, the wiring may need to be repaired or replaced.

2. Incorrect wire gauge: Another common issue is using the incorrect wire gauge for the brake controller. The wire gauge should be appropriate for the amount of current that the brake controller will draw. Using a wire that is too thin can result in the wire overheating and potentially causing a fire. It’s important to consult the vehicle’s manual or a professional to determine the correct wire gauge for the brake controller.

3. Incompatibility with the vehicle’s electrical system: Some brake controllers may not be compatible with the electrical system of the 2016 Sprinter. This can result in the brake controller not working properly or not working at all. It’s important to ensure that the brake controller is compatible with the vehicle’s electrical system before installation. This may require consulting the manufacturer’s documentation or speaking with a professional.
